CSL trades at 19.5x earnings with short interest at 7.75%—notably elevated for a fabricated rubber products company. The stock sits 52.8 on RSI, right in neutral territory, suggesting neither momentum-driven buying nor selling pressure dominates. Trading below its 52-week high despite a $14.3B market cap indicates recent pullback, though the valuation isn't yet cheap relative to cyclical peers. The moderate short position combined with middling technical readings hints at cautious positioning rather than conviction betting. This setup lacks the extreme compression or technical extremes that typically precede aggressive directional moves.
